前几种方法都是在段落开头加入一些东西,利用占位法设置缩进效果,而使用CSS设置缩进效果则更容易,也便于修改。 text-indenet属性就是缩进元素中的首行文本,它可以取正值或负值。比如我们想让所有的段落首行都缩进两个字符的宽度就可以设置段落的CSS属性,举例:p {text-indent:2em;} 这里我设置的值为2em,em是一个相对单位,2em就是页面字体的两倍大小,当页面字体为12像素时,首行缩进就是24像素,当页面字体为14像素时,首行缩进就成了28像素。 Read More
posted @ 2012-05-29 20:16
-禅意花园-
Views(469)
Comments(0)
Diggs(0)
可能的值值描述normal默认值。定义标准的字符。bold定义粗体字符。bolder定义更粗的字符。lighter定义更细的字符。100200300400500600700800900定义由粗到细的字符。400 等同于 normal,而 700 等同于 bold。inherit规定应该从父元素继承字体的粗细。 Read More
posted @ 2012-05-29 20:02
-禅意花园-
Views(161)
Comments(0)
Diggs(0)
颜色在CSS里的应用非常广泛,如:color,border,background,box-shadow等的属性都接受颜色值作为属性值。CSS颜色值的设置也是多样化的,以下是到目前为止CSS中颜色值设置的方法。CSS 预定义颜色(就是使用颜色的英文)W3C定义了一组SVG的颜色表,同样是CSS颜色模块所指的颜色,他们是一些指向特定颜色的单词,如:white, black ,red等。color:red; color:green; color:blue;transparent 关键字transparent 表示完全透明,CSS1中,它只能在 background 属性中使用,CSS2中,添加到了 Read More
posted @ 2012-05-29 19:59
-禅意花园-
Views(1208)
Comments(0)
Diggs(0)
overflow 属性规定当内容溢出元素框时发生的事情。可能的值值描述visible默认值。内容不会被修剪,会呈现在元素框之外。hidden内容会被修剪,并且其余内容是不可见的。scroll内容会被修剪,但是浏览器会显示滚动条以便查看其余的内容。auto如果内容被修剪,则浏览器会显示滚动条以便查看其余的内容。inherit规定应该从父元素继承 overflow 属性的值。 Read More
posted @ 2012-05-29 18:24
-禅意花园-
Views(219)
Comments(0)
Diggs(0)
1.*是通用选择符,匹配文档中的任何元素2.background-position:10px 0;前一个是水平位置 后一个是垂直位置。 Read More
posted @ 2012-05-29 17:47
-禅意花园-
Views(92)
Comments(0)
Diggs(0)
网站用户界面设计(俗称网页设计)命名规范。这套规范并非单纯的CSS、html或JavaScript命名规范,它涉及了很多使用PhotoShop这类设计工具进行网页设计过程中的命名规范。首先作者是出于公司几位美工的设计效果图源文件没有对图层命名而开始考虑总结一套的,还有一个原因就是网上大多命名规范都是关于编码的,也就是那些css、html、js和一些服务器端语言的,至于设计方面的命名规范实在是很少。但是毕竟设计师也是技术团队的成员,而且前端开发工程师是要使用设计师的效果图源文件的,所以统一命名规范和设计规范对于团队的协作和工作效率肯定是有好处的。一.网站设计及基本框架结构:1. Containe Read More
posted @ 2012-05-29 09:23
-禅意花园-
Views(293)
Comments(0)
Diggs(0)